RA-4
RA-4, a research reactor (homogeneous) in Rosario, Argentina, with 1 W of thermal power, operated by Instituto de Estudios Nucleares y Radiaciones Ionizantes. Operating, first critical in 1972.
By thermal power it ranks fifth among the 5 research reactors operating in Argentina. It went critical 14 years after the first research reactor in Argentina, RA-1 Enrico Fermi Reactor (1958). It is one of 15 homogeneous reactors operating worldwide, spread across 6 countries. Its declared uses include teaching and training.
